Registered name: Carlyle Senior Care of Williston
Williston, SC · Medicare-certified · 44 beds
Williston Healthcare & Rehabilitation LLC has a 3 out of 5 star overall rating, with 3-star ratings for health inspections, staffing, and quality measures. Reported nurse staffing is 3.79 hours per resident per day, below the federal benchmark of 4.1, and there were $0 in fines in the last 24 months.

The home failed to keep residents’ personal and medical records private and confidential. Cited June 2023 — widespread issue, potential for harm.
F-Tag 583 — 42 CFR §483.10 — S/S: F
The home failed to ensure residents had a safe, clean, comfortable, homelike environment and daily care supports were provided safely. Cited April 2026 — limited pattern, potential for harm.
F-Tag 584 — 42 CFR §483.10 — S/S: E
The nursing home failed to make sure each resident got an accurate assessment of their needs and condition. Cited April 2026 — isolated incident, potential for harm.
F-Tag 641 — 42 CFR §483.20(g) — S/S: D
The nursing home failed to provide appropriate treatment and care according to residents' orders, preferences, and goals. Cited April 2026 — isolated incident, potential for harm.
F-Tag 684 — 42 CFR §483.25 — S/S: D
The home failed to properly label and securely store medications and biologicals. Cited April 2026 — isolated incident, potential for harm.
F-Tag 761 — 42 CFR §483.45(g) — S/S: D
